Scope of India-Mauritius space cooperation will foster new era, says Pravind Jugnauth

By IBNS
Jul 17, 2024..

Mauritius Prime Minister Pravind Jugnauth expressed hope that the overall scope of space cooperation between India and his nation may foster a new era that might flow of data relating to the territory.


He commented during the inauguration of projects and the exchange of a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) between India and Mauritius in Port Louis.

Indian External Affairs Minister S Jaishankar was present on the occasion.

Pravind Jugnauth was quoted as saying by ANI, “This morning, I had a bilateral meeting with His Excellency, Dr Jaishankar. During this, we had truthful discussions on the future contours of a strategic partnership between Mauritius and India. A moment ago, we proceeded with an e-inauguration of 12 high-impact community development projects which will benefit the entire population.”

Speaking about the exchange of project plan document for India-Mauritius joint satellite between ISRO and MRIC, Jugnauth said, “Following the launching ceremony, we had exchange of instruments, cooperation which relate to development of National institute for curriculum research, Mauritius for the Mauritius Institute of Education, the digitisation of the Indian immigration archives at the Mahatma Gandhi Institute, the Indian Council for Cultural Relations, and the Chair for Sanskrit and Indian philosophy at the Mahatma Gandhi Institute, the exchange of the project plan document for India-Mauritius joint satellite between the Indian Space Research Organisation and Mauritius Research and Innovation Council.”

Jugnauth said, “The overall scope of the India-Mauritius space cooperation will foster a new era, which will allow the flow of data pertaining to our territory, the establishment of India-Mauritius space portal providing value-added services and will unlock new avenues for the utilisation of space technologies. Mauritius remains committed to maximise the use of renewable energy as laid out in the renewable energy roadmap 2030. I know we can count on India’s support in achieving these objectives.”
